• CEE FÜLLEMANN
    • About

      Cee Füllemann’s works highlight an economy of proximity and relations that resist dominant structures. Their recent researches are exploring forms of intimacies and present them as fundamental approaches to create a space for collaborative work and shared knowledge. Working at the intersection of performance and sculpture, they are interested in emphasizing the experience of material as living organisms.

INTIMATE ESTRANGEMENT
  • INFOS
    • Curated by Disorder and Sofia Wickman at Mikro, Zürich

       

      Intimate Estrangement is an exhibition with the conviction that through disorder,
      through disruption or the non-normalized perspective we can gain new knowledge
      and new insights, which in the long run will lead to new outlook, positioning and
      behaviour. Perhaps something we otherwise would not have encountered.
      Intimate Estrangement is a love declaration to the alien, to the extraterrestrial, may
      it be within this society or in our Self’s. Perhaps something the outside world told
      you to cast away...
      Introducing three perspectives through three oeuvres.
      A live music improvisation with video, streaming on the opening night by

      Katrina Burch. Her compositional experiments aim to touch invisible spaces bet-
      ween thought: sonic tracings of discretized memories, and impressions of infini-
      tesimal changes. In flux one might hear slow transformations of a baby’s voice in

      silent tempo, their soft breath impressing upon the ears of the heart. In Waves

      (Aqua Mercurialis) is a composition of audiovisuals and poetry that is the soft cul-
      mination of four years of healing a traumatic abortion.

      A series of new works by Christopher Füllemann, that are the fruit of a research
      around notions towards possible care and resilience. The series was made as a
      protective spell called Nothing new but new moons to bring collective care against

      normalcy in the midst of global turmoil. Füllemann’s sculptures consist of human-
      transformed material together with plants and herbs to create an evolving sub-
      stance that grows and infiltrates in various (un)defined shapes. This exchange, or

      rather, this alliance is constantly effected, materially, by each other and further-
      more are potential sites for growth allowing rituals to offer protections. Each work

      is fragmented, transitioning between organic and artificial to create extension of
      ideas for future bodies.
